And while the drama has star names leading the cast - including Noel Clarke, Catherine Tyldesley, Phil Davis and Bronagh Waugh - Manchester itself has a starring role in the action.
The thriller is about a covert police surveillance operation on a Manchester street after the mysterious disappearance of a school teacher and was all shot on location in and around the city last year.
